СР
Size: a a a
СР
b
libpostalData после успешного билда оказывается пусто. Вот такой default.nix у меня: https://gist.github.com/kaivi/178630cfa723ddef8c7cbf8a2cf51ff7АБ
libpostalData лучше сделать runCommand "libpostal-data" ''...АБ
АБ
АБ
pkgs.fetchgit вместо builtins.fetchGitb
pkgs.fetchgit вместо builtins.fetchGitb
АБ
АБ
src каждые tarball-ttlАБ
pkgs.fetchgitАБ
АБ
niv.АБ
b
libpostal это единственная депенденси во всем проекте, которая указана у этой деривации питоновской обертки для нее:{ pkgs
, stdenv
, buildPythonPackage
, six
, nose
}: buildPythonPackage rec {
name = "postal-1.1.8";
src = pkgs.fetchurl {
url = "https://github.com/openvenues/pypostal/archive/1.0.tar.gz";
sha256 = "12190cm8339ry2y5mdp2a3slryzgrxgkf8rv9hrj723z1sjg73v0";
};
buildInputs = [
(pkgs.callPackage ../libpostal/default.nix {})
nose
];
propagatedBuildInputs = [
six
];
doCheck = true;
}doCheck = true оно зафейлится на тестах со словами Error loading libpostal data.АБ
b